Great location less than 20 minutes from KHH airport. It is within 8 minutes walking distance from SOGO for those who love to shop department stores. There are 7-11s ( more than one!) Family Marts and a PX Mart (grocery store) along each road. Very convenient. The drinks at 7-11 will be cheaper priced than Family Mart and PX Mart and sometimes they will have a BOGO on select items ( I got an extra baby wipe pack by sheer luck). The Family Mart will have more unique items (ex Kombucha, health teas etc). The food selection for both places will be a bit limited for grab and go eats. Think sweet pastries and snacks. They do have some sandwiches but not super healthy if you are vegetarian. The hotel has complementary breakfast that starts at 6:30am ends at 10am. It is a buffet the fills up the entire room. There is a wonderful mix of local foods, one Western style pot. There is a small salad bar, fruit bar, coffee/tea and a small short order cook that will fry up 4 items (eggs, scallion onion omelette, turnip cakes). There is an other side has at least 10 varieties of local foods. The quality is great! Not too oily, 2 congee pots ( regular and Hong Kong Style). Fruits include what is season (Guava, apples, watermelon) and oranges, bananas. I will warn you about the late night snack (Dim Sum) buffet. Located on same floor and it starts at 7pm. That is a busy mad house. The line to queue up starts earlier and it will go down the hall to the stairwell. Lots of tour buses come to this location and tour groups will flood in each week during season. I went during early April for 9 days. I would go to breakfast at 8 am and skipped the nighttime crush. Restaurants are readily available all around and very affordable. This hotel comes with complimentary laundry DIY and laundry powder soap. Make sure you write your room number on the dry erase placard and stick it on each machine you use. Otherwise another guest may accidentally throw their items in and use the machine. The dryers are on top so hard to see what’s on the bottom. There is a free lounge in the lobby that has complimentary ice cream, coffee/tea and jasmine flavored gelatin cups. You can sit there all day if you like and sip on a free espresso or other drink. This hotel comes with a lot of amenities at a reasonable rate— I will stay here again next time.

Great location, able to take MRT (redline) directly from Kaohsiung airport to Kaohsiung Main Station , then just walk across the street, hotel is right there. Hotel room is reasonable size, nicely setup. Since it's close to MRT station, you can get to anywhere easily. Great food choices including street food is just within walking distance. We left Kaohsiung to Taipei by high speed train, it's also very easy to get to Zuo-ying Station from hotel. Just take TRA local train (station is same as the MRT station) to New Zuo-Ying Station and transfer to the high speed train. It was a bit confusing in the beginning but if you ask anyone at the station, they are always happy to answer you. People are extremely friendly
